Production Assembly Technician

Location: Permanent
Hours: 8:30am until 5pm (Monday to Friday)
Salary: £28,000 to £32,000

Polytec Ltd. is seeking a skilled Production Assembly Technician to join our team. As a key member of our production team, you will be responsible for assembling and testing RF products, ensuring high-quality standards compliant with ISO9001.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Assemble and sub-assemble RF products, including light electromechanical assembly and prep work
  2. Perform RF and electrical testing using automated test software
  3. Maintain accurate schedules and work records
  4. Manufacture custom parts and/or cables as required
  5. Manage stock and component kits
  6. Support process and product improvement initiatives

Requirements:

  1. Ability to complete assembly work to high-quality standards compliant with ISO9001
  2. Understanding of mechanical drawings, wiring diagrams, and other documentation
  3. Excellent communication skills and attention to detail
  4. Ability to work effectively and meet deadlines within a team and on individual tasks

Desirable Skills:

  1. Good soldering skills
  2. Experience with RF testing
  3. Clean driving licence
